Delaware Passes a Minimum Wage Increase

Date: February 24, 2014

Legislation increasing
Delaware’s minimum wage to $1 above the federal rate sailed through the
legislature last week with little debate. 
Not only did
Senate Bill 6
clear both the House and Senate on Thursday, January 30, but Governor Markell
also quickly signed it in to law that same day.

This new law will raise the minimum wage in Delaware to $8.25 per
hour in two increments. Delaware’s hourly minimum wage will go up 50 cents to
$7.75 on June 1, 2014.  And on June 1,
2015, it will go up another 50 cents to $8.25 per hour. NFIB strongly opposed
this bill.

“It’s a 13 percent increase in less than 12 months. Most small
businesses will find a way to cope with it, but some will have to make tough
choices.  So we’re creating winners and losers.” said NFIB State Director Jessica Cooper.
